Box hedging is probably one of the best known formal hedging plants; its small, glossy green leaves are densely packed on slow growing, bushy plants. For its use in topiary it is second to none as it will tolerate regular clipping to keep it in shape & has traditionally been used in formal gardens around the world. Box plants provide low maintenance structure to the garden all year round. ...
This impressive summer bulb resembles a unique mix of daffodil & amaryllis&33; The sulphur yellow flowers, with their large green striped trumpets & gentle fragrance are borne on leafless stems from May to July. This stunning Spider Lily holds an RHS AGM. Hymenocallis Sulphur Queen is best grown in containers that can be moved to a warm greenhouse or conservatory during the winter months with a minimum temperature of 15°C &40;59°F&41;. Try this brand new Candytuft for a parade of pastel pink flowers from late spring to midsummer. This hardy perennial carries its pretty blooms in eye&45;catching, flattened panicles which are followed by attractive seed heads. Iberis Pink Ice has a low growing, spreading habit that is well suited to rockeries & path edges, as well as borders & patio containers. Height: 25cm &40;10&34;&41;. Spread: 40cm &40;16&34;&41;. Supplied in 7cm pots. Culinary information: Both the leaves & flowers of candytuft can be eaten raw & have a taste similar to that of a sweet broccoli.
